Lalor is located 17 km north of the CBD. Bounded by the Merri Creek in the west and the Darebin Creek in the east Lalor is a residential and industrial suburb. The largest ethnic groups are from the countries of the fromer Yugoslavia Greece and Italy. Its labour force is concentrated in the manufacturing sector (33%) while a significant portion are employed in the wholesale and retail trade sector. The area also features significant commercial areas centred around the Lalor railway station.
